What to Know About Peñaranda de Bracamonte

Key Facts

Peñaranda de Bracamonte is a municipality and town located in the province of Salamanca, within the autonomous community of Castilla y León in western Spain. Situated approximately 40 kilometers east of the provincial capital Salamanca, this historic settlement lies in the fertile Tierra de Peñaranda comarca, characterized by its agricultural plains and strategic position along traditional communication routes between Salamanca and Ávila. With a municipal area covering approximately 23 square kilometers, Peñaranda de Bracamonte serves as an important commercial and service center for the surrounding rural areas. The town has a population of around 6,000 inhabitants, maintaining stable demographic figures in recent years despite broader rural depopulation trends in the region. Administratively, the municipality functions as the capital of its judicial district and contains the single urban center of Peñaranda de Bracamonte itself, without additional separate population nuclei. Historically significant for its well-preserved Renaissance and Baroque architecture, particularly the Church of San Miguel and the Carmelite convent, the town also benefits from its proximity to major transportation corridors while preserving its traditional Castilian character.
